The kernel packages contain the Linux kernel, the core of any Linux operating system.

Security Fix(es):

  • kernel: Integer overflow in Intel® Graphics Drivers (CVE-2020-12362)

  • kernel: memory leak in sof_set_get_large_ctrl_data() function in sound/soc/sof/ipc.c (CVE-2019-18811)

  • kernel: use-after-free caused by a malicious USB device in the drivers/usb/misc/adutux.c driver (CVE-2019-19523)

  • kernel: use-after-free bug caused by a malicious USB device in the drivers/usb/misc/iowarrior.c driver (CVE-2019-19528)

  • kernel: possible out of bounds write in kbd_keycode of keyboard.c (CVE-2020-0431)

  • kernel: DoS by corrupting mountpoint reference counter (CVE-2020-12114)

  • kernel: use-after-free in usb_sg_cancel function in drivers/usb/core/message.c (CVE-2020-12464)

  • kernel: buffer uses out of index in ext3/4 filesystem (CVE-2020-14314)

  • kernel: Use After Free vulnerability in cgroup BPF component (CVE-2020-14356)

  • kernel: NULL pointer dereference in serial8250_isa_init_ports function in drivers/tty/serial/8250/8250_core.c (CVE-2020-15437)

  • kernel: umask not applied on filesystem without ACL support (CVE-2020-24394)

  • kernel: TOCTOU mismatch in the NFS client code (CVE-2020-25212)

  • kernel: incomplete permission checking for access to rbd devices (CVE-2020-25284)

  • kernel: race condition between hugetlb sysctl handlers in mm/hugetlb.c (CVE-2020-25285)

  • kernel: improper input validation in ppp_cp_parse_cr function leads to memory corruption and read overflow (CVE-2020-25643)

  • kernel: perf_event_parse_addr_filter memory (CVE-2020-25704)

  • kernel: use-after-free in kernel midi subsystem (CVE-2020-27786)

  • kernel: child process is able to access parent mm through hfi dev file handle (CVE-2020-27835)

  • kernel: slab-out-of-bounds read in fbcon (CVE-2020-28974)

  • kernel: fork: fix copy_process(CLONE_PARENT) race with the exiting ->real_parent (CVE-2020-35508)

  • kernel: fuse: fuse_do_getattr() calls make_bad_inode() in inappropriate situations (CVE-2020-36322)

  • kernel: use after free in tun_get_user of tun.c could lead to local escalation of privilege (CVE-2021-0342)

  • kernel: NULL pointer dereferences in ov511_mode_init_regs and ov518_mode_init_regs in drivers/media/usb/gspca/ov519.c (CVE-2020-11608)
